Solucionado (ver solução)
Solucionado
(ver solução)
6
respostas

Como saber o endereço para consulta

Eu já havia instalado o Oracle 12C antes de ver esse curso e não fui pelo modo avançado, logo não anotei esse endereço onde podemos consultar e criar o usuário.

Como faço para obter essa informação no meu banco? Existe algum comando?

6 respostas

Para criar um usuário você pode usar o:

CREATE USER "Nome do Usuario" IDENTIFIED BY "Senha";

OBS: Sem as aspas.

você pode tentar usar a query "select username from dba_users;" para descobrir os usuários também.

Alguns links com matérias mais completas, se vc precisar:

https://docs.oracle.com/database/121/DBSEG/users.htm#DBSEG573

http://www.devmedia.com.br/criando-usuarios-e-liberando-privilegios-e-atribuicoes-no-oracle/26414

Ok, mas gostaria de saber como faço para ter o endereço do Oracle enterprise manager que é mostrado na aula.

Porque como mencionei, fiz a instalação antes da aula e não anotei esse endereço.

Se vc se refere a URL do EM Dabatase Manager, normalmente é: https://localhost:5500/em Caso não der, a porta pode ser diferente, para descobrir ela é só executar a query:

select dbms_xdb.getHttpPort() from dual;

Dei o comando e retornou:

DBMS_XDB.GETHTTPORT()

0

solução!

tenta usar o comando

SQL> exec dbms_xdb_config.sethttpport(PORTA);

trocando o "PORTA" pela porta que vc quer, por exemplo 8080 ou 5500, depois volta a executar o comando.

depois vc tenta entrar na quele link da resposta anterior trocando a prota que está la por a que vc definiu.

fonte: https://technology.amis.nl/2013/06/26/oracle-12c-getting-started-with-db-express/

É a porta 8080, mas como o Oracle 11 usa essa porta também, acho que por isso tá dando conflito. Vou procurar aqui para mudar a porta do 12C.